Transaction 650d86e6cfedf3309808e2ac959ea200685017a088afb36127fc38ec8f38a9ea
1 Input
1 Output
-
650d86e6cfedf3309808e2ac959ea200685017a088afb36127fc38ec8f38a9ea:0
- value
- 12654487
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3f70e4d8dd74960020cd0f5565ee893b8895c00
- address
- bc1qu0msunvd6aykqqsv6r64vhhgjwugjhqqpqmpqh